Conversely, Midwestern Universitys Arizona College of Optometry accepted students in 2013 with average scores of 319 (academic) and 315 (total science) (tied for fifth lowest) and a 3.37 GPA (seventh lowest) and, yet, 95.4% of its students pass boards. Fifty years ago, a group of ambitious young ODs were dismayed to find many of the diagnostic and therapeutic skills they learned in optometry school could not legally be put into practice.11 They lobbied legislators for change and transformed optometry from a refraction-based job to a primary eye care profession. Of the six lowest GPAs accepted in the United States last year, five come from the newest institutions (Table 2). Students seeking admission to AZCOPT must submit the following documented evidence: A minimum cumulative GPA and science coursework GPA of 2.75 on a 4.00 scale. Optometry board pass rates published in late 2017 found a national rate of 91%, with some schools falling well below the average (Table 4).6 Above-average student populations dont always correlate with below-average pass rates. Look at Nova Southeastern University in Ft. Lauderdale, Fla., which has hosted more than 100 students per class since 2011 and its average incoming GPA in 2014 was 3.36, tied for fourth lowest. The College of Optometry at NSU has a nearly 98-percent pass rate, honoring the schools mission statement of training, educating, and preparing future optometric physicians to do their work professionally, proficiently, and with integrity. You dont want to be all academic and no personal skills., In fact, in a 2008 ASCO survey, eight schools rated students OAT scores significant in influencing their admission process, another eight rated it only moderate and one even said it had no influence at all. 1 18 Responses: 5 0 Responses: 318: 3.4: Western University of Health Sciences College of Optometry Optometry School Pomona, CA : 1: $36,140. A physics major from University of Chicago may have only graduated with 2.95, but someone with that degree from that school will likely perform well in optometry school, as long as their OAT scores measure up.
